This single-vineyard cru is La Gerla`s flagship wine, made only in select years. The 2015 vintage is one of the finest of the decade. Notes of new leather, forest floor and ripe woodland berries aromas on the nose along with scents of violets and tobacco. Full-bodied and firmly structured, the palate offers finesse and concentrated flavours including crushed raspberries, Morello cherries, liquorice and truffles, framed in polished tannins. Drink now through to 2030.

The 2015 Brunello di Montalcino Riserva Gli Angeli is drop-dead gorgeous, as it keeps you coming back to the glass over and over to take in its alluring display of rich dark fruits with sweet mint, mulling spice and a grounding hint of flowery undergrowth. Its textures are seamless, coasting across a core of vibrant acids, which enliven its flavors of black cherry and currants. You can almost forget how youthful the 2015 is today, as it comes across as juicy at times. That said, there’s plenty of structure here to carry it for many years in the cellar. Notes of licorice, tobacco and sweet herbs linger long over a gentle coating of fine tannin. This may be dangerously delicious today; yet after just a few years of cellaring, I expect the Riserva Gli Angeli to fully blossom and provide a long and open drinking window. A Bright Star in Montalcino

Founded by the late Sergio Rossi in 1976, La Gerla is one of the leading estates in Montalcino, Tuscany. Originally named Colombaio, the estate was previously owned by the Biondi-Santi family. The main vineyards of this beautiful estate are located at the foot of the Montalcino hill in Canalicchio, at 320m above sea level. During his time in charge, Rossi extended the vineyard holdings by purchasing 5ha of vines in Castelnuovo dell’Abate. The estate is now run by vineyard manager Alberto Passeri and winemaker Vittorio Fiore.

La Gerla produces five wines, all made from massal-selected Sangiovese Grosso grapes: Poggio Gli Angeli is produced from young vines in Castelnuovo and matured for four months in Slavonian oak botti; Rosso di Montalcino spends two years in cask, one of which is in Slavonian oak; Birba is a declassified Brunello di Montalcino which spends one year in barrique and a year in Slavonian oak; Brunello is a blend of Sangiovese grapes from Canalicchio and Castelnuovo, aged for three years in cask and one year on bottle; and finally Brunello gli Angeli is a riserva made in exceptional vintages from 1ha of old vines. This long-lived wine is matured for four years in Slavonian oak and a further year in bottle before release.
